Output acabefac93cb2a831733b8a128c4efbbc05f27f980d4a2f48a8389adacd96e3c:0

value
587760
script pubkey
OP_0 OP_PUSHBYTES_20 6aac0151b0f6e8bf89d4745baef65ad5156f9058
address
bc1qd2kqz5ds7m5tlzw5w3d6aaj6652klyzc2q4wp0
transaction
acabefac93cb2a831733b8a128c4efbbc05f27f980d4a2f48a8389adacd96e3c
spent
true